Receiving random Paypal money

Three times I have now been sent a small amount of money from a stranger on Paypal. These have come from two different people who don’t seem to exist when I google search for them. The amounts are only small, a few pounds each. I wonder if this is somehow some convoluted scam? Does anyone have any ideas please?! I want to refund the money but I am concerned if giving away something about myself if I do?!

    Could be a scam however it is also possible that someone with a similar email address has given out the wrong information. A third party has subsequently 'paid' for something using paypal but like sending it to the wrong account number, the wrong email address is used.

    You only need an email address to pay someone on paypal - get that wrong when you try and pay someone and your money goes astray if it matches an existing account.

    Are any of the amounts the same and received recently?
